csiro, through this rft, is seeking responses from suitably qualified and experienced service providers for the provision of mechanical services for a transmitter and servo bearing cooling upgrade on deep space station 43 dss43 at the canberra deep space communication complex cdscc. the existing cooling systems serving the existing transmitters on dss43 are inadequate for the planned new x and s-band transmitters on that antenna. these cooling systems will be removed when the transmitters are replaced, and the new cooling configuration will combine the new transmitter cooling system with a new servo bearing cooling system. the new system, the subject of this rft, will utilise the latest technology adiabatic coolers, eliminating risk of legionella, simplifying plant maintenance, and ensuring adequate cooling capacity and capability for dss43 into the indefinite future.

defence high frequency communications system dhfcs is reaching life of type and the commonwealth of australia has committed to enhancing this capability to reach 2040. dhfcs provides a long range strategic communications capability to defence assets and other government agencies. dhfcs consists of 8 remote sites across continental australia, 2 central sites in canberra and a test facility at the incumbent contractor’s premises in brisbane. the successful tenderer will be required to provide operation, maintenance and support of the dhfcs whilst enhancing the capability to meet stakeholder requirements. a full background to the requirement, and an overview of the rft is set out in the conditions of tender project rft overview.
